Steps on the Web

To cancel via the web, follow these steps:

Navigate to the official Microsoft account website and sign in with your credentials.

Locate the section titled "Subscriptions" or "Services."

Find the entry for Xbox Game Pass and select the "Manage" or "Cancel" option.

Follow the on-screen prompts to confirm the cancellation, selecting a reason if prompted.

Steps on Console

To cancel on your Xbox:

Go to the Home screen and navigate to "Profile & System" or "Account."

Select "Subscriptions" from the menu.

Find Xbox Game Pass and press "A" to view details.

Choose "Cancel Subscription" and confirm your selection.

Managing Your Game Library

Cancelling your subscription has a direct impact on your digital library. Once the service ends, any games installed from Game Pass will become inaccessible. You will retain the ability to purchase these games permanently if you choose, but the instant access granted by the subscription will cease. It is wise to review your installed games and decide which ones you wish to keep.

Understanding Billing and Refunds

When learning how to end Xbox Game Pass, timing is a critical factor. The cancellation takes effect at the end of the current billing period, meaning you will still have access for the days you have already paid for. Microsoft typically does not issue refunds for the remaining days of a billing cycle after cancellation. Therefore, cancelling mid-cycle does not usually result in a monetary return.
